#647ba2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#647ba2 is composed of 39.2% red, 48.2% green and 63.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 38.3% cyan, 24.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 36.5% black. It has a hue angle of 217.7 degrees, a saturation of 25% and a lightness of 51.4%. #647ba2 color hex could be obtained by blending #c8f6ff with #000045.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

Shades and Tints of #647ba2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030304 is the darkest color, while #f7f8f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#647ba2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#818285 is the less saturated color, while #0e65f8 is the most saturated one.
